Vitamin A

Vitamin A is essential for maintaining healthy ears and hearing. It helps to prevent hearing loss by protecting the delicate structures in the inner ear. Foods rich in Vitamin A include carrots, sweet potatoes, and spinach. Additionally, you can take Vitamin A supplements to ensure you are getting an adequate amount.

Vitamin C

Vitamin C is known for its antioxidant properties, which can help reduce inflammation in the ears and prevent infections. It also supports the immune system, which is crucial for fighting off ear infections. Foods high in Vitamin C include citrus fruits, bell peppers, and strawberries.

Vitamin E

Vitamin E is another important vitamin for ear health. It helps to improve circulation in the blood vessels of the inner ear, which can prevent hearing loss. Nuts, seeds, and leafy greens are excellent sources of Vitamin E.

Zinc

Zinc is a mineral that plays a vital role in maintaining ear health. It can help reduce tinnitus and hearing loss by protecting the hair cells in the inner ear. Foods rich in zinc include oysters, beef, and lentils. Zinc supplements are also available for those who may not get enough from their diet.

Magnesium

Magnesium is essential for proper nerve function and can help prevent hearing loss. It also has a relaxing effect on the blood vessels, which can improve circulation in the ears. Foods high in magnesium include nuts, seeds, and whole grains.

FAQs

1. Can vitamins improve hearing loss?

While vitamins can support ear health and prevent hearing loss, they may not necessarily reverse existing hearing loss. It's essential to consult with a healthcare professional if you are experiencing hearing loss.

2. Are there any side effects of taking vitamin supplements for ear health?

Most vitamin supplements are safe when taken in recommended doses. However, it's essential to follow the guidelines on the packaging and cons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new supplement regimen.
